Ubuntu上使用Shadowsocks-Manager的完整教程

目录

简介

Shadowsocks-Manager是一个用于管理Shadowsocks服务器的工具。本教程将介绍如何在Ubuntu上安装和配置Shadowsocks-Manager,并提供使用教程和常见问题解答。

安装Shadowsocks-Manager

依赖安装

在安装Shadowsocks-Manager之前,需要安装一些依赖包。打开终端并执行以下命令:

sudo apt-get update sudo apt-get install python3 python3-pip python3-dev build-essential

下载Shadowsocks-Manager

在终端中执行以下命令来下载Shadowsocks-Manager:

git clone https://github.com/shadowsocks/shadowsocks-manager.git

配置Shadowsocks-Manager

进入Shadowsocks-Manager目录并编辑config.py文件,配置管理员用户名和密码等选项:

cd shadowsocks-manager nano config.py

编辑完成后保存并退出。

启动Shadowsocks-Manager

在终端中执行以下命令启动Shadowsocks-Manager:

cd shadowsocks-manager python3 manager.py

使用教程

创建用户

使用Web浏览器访问http://localhost:4000,输入管理员用户名和密码后,点击登录。在用户管理页面,点击“创建用户”按钮,填写用户信息并点击“确定”。

管理用户

在用户管理页面,可以查看已创建的用户列表,包括用户名、端口和密码等信息。可以编辑用户信息、重置密码或删除用户。

查看统计信息

在统计信息页面,可以查看服务器的连接数、流量使用情况等信息。

常见问题解答

问题1:如何解决安装依赖出错的问题?

如果在安装依赖时出现错误,可以尝试以下解决方法:

  • 确保网络连接正常。
  • 更新系统软件包并重试。
  • 手动安装依赖包。

问题2:如何修改Shadowsocks-Manager的默认端口?

在config.py文件中,找到PORT选项并修改为新的端口号。

问题3:如何重置Shadowsocks-Manager的管理员密码?

可以在config.py文件中修改ADMIN_PASSWORD选项为新的密码。

正文完